Flavour's Technical Blog

A Blog About Front-end Technology


  • 首页

  • 标签

  • 分类

  • 归档

pre-commit使用

发表于 2018-08 | 分类于 插件使用
pre-commit简介一个结合git对项目的代码提交进行拦截的工具,可以配合eslint对代码风格的统一规范 安装123npm install --save-dev pre-commitnpm install --save-dev eslint-friendly-formatternpm inst ...
阅读全文 »

项目心得总结

发表于 2018-08 | 分类于 心得
1. 慎用element.innerHTML:因为有的时候原先dom里面的一些元素注册了一些事件,当你直接innerHTML的时候,会直接替换掉那些已经注册了事件的dom元素,会导致你的一些js效果出现问题,而且在页面的性能上也有造成不小的消耗,所以说需要更新页面的数据的时候,需要最小程度的更新do ...
阅读全文 »

eslint配置介绍

发表于 2018-08 | 分类于 工具使用
eslint配置介绍具体配置 可参照 官网123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869 ...
阅读全文 »

写出高性能的js代码

发表于 2018-08 | 分类于 随谈
写出高性能的js代码一、加载运行javascript在浏览器中的性能,大概是开发者面对最重要的问题。因为javascript的阻塞特征,也就是在javascipt运行的过程中,其他的事情并不能被浏览器处理。所以javascript运行的越长,浏览器等待的时间就越长。所以应该 把脚本放在底部(通常就是 ...
阅读全文 »

浅谈js对象的属性设置

发表于 2018-08 | 分类于 随谈
浅谈js对象的属性设置何为面向对象面向对象的定义是比较好比喻的,比如一个人,有什么特征,这是特征就是对象属性,而不同的人又相同的地方和自身亮点;这样就是从单一对象过渡到继承,拓展;[注:ES6之前没有类的说法,原生的继承也是不存在的;模拟居多] ECMA的定义就是: “无序属性的几何,其属性可以包含 ...
阅读全文 »
1234
Flavour Jiang

Flavour Jiang

一个属于自己的空间

17 日志
7 分类
19 标签
GitHub Weibo ZhiHu
© 2018 Flavour Jiang
由 Hexo 强力驱动
|
主题 — NexT.Mist v5.1.4